WebJun 25, 2014 · Ned Kelly’s history. When only 10 years old, Kelly was acknowledged locally as a hero after he courageously saved a seven-year-old boy from drowning. The child, Dick Shelton, had fallen into rain-swollen Hughes Creek, in Avenel, 100km north of Melbourne, when he tried to retrieve his new straw hat, which had dropped off as he walked across a ... WebAug 14, 2024 · On 14 October 1869, 14-year-old Ned was arrested for stealing money from a Chinese man. Kelly spent ten days in the police station lockup but there was not enough proof to send Ned to court and he had to be set free. Who was Ned Kelly and what did he do? WebAn 1880 illustration showing Ned Kelly's helmet and armour suit complete with an apron and shoulder plates. The gang's armour was made of iron 6 mm thick, each consisting of a long breast-plate, shoulder-plates, back … WebNed Kelly was sentenced to death and hanged at Old Melbourne Gaol on November 11th, 1880. He was just 25 years old. Ned Kelly became the last man to be hanged in Australia and the events at Glenrowan ended the bushranger era in Australia. Today, Ned Kelly is considered a folk hero by many Australians. His story has been told in books, movies ...
